What to check before for pre-war buildings near the B9 bus in Brooklyn

  • Confirm the exact commute you need. “Near the B9” depends on building location, so verify the walk time and schedule in real conditions.
  • Ask what “pre-war” means for your unit. In older buildings, confirm heat/water, window condition, noise, and whether any renovations are recent and documented.
  • Check regulatory status and lease terms early. Pre-war buildings can be under different rent-stabilization or tenant-protection scenarios, which can affect renewal and rent changes.
  • Review the full move-in cost. Even before applying, confirm the broker fee, security deposit, and any required up-front charges on the building page or with the leasing office.
  • Use the tenant Q&A to screen questions you’d otherwise forget. Then ask the building directly about anything that isn’t answered (maintenance response times, laundry access, package handling).
